Hi Eng Wei

The thermal model does not provide a thermal design power value, we plan to have an FPGA wattage of about 200 watts. How to distribute power on FPGA core and transceiver(Main,HSSI0_0~ HSSI2_1)?

Hi Wilson

The CTMs do not have power. The power comes form EPE or PTC based on the design resource usage. If you have the PTC for this design, with that the Engineering team can provide the powers for each tile and few other thermal parameters. Also please refer to the doc below for more details on thermal analysis of Stratix 10:
